Jay,
OK this is what I got working on my end:
var infoHighwayCameras = new InfoTemplate();
infoHighwayCameras.setTitle("Highway Cameras");
infoHighwayCameras.setContent(getTextContent);
function getTextContent(graphic) {
return "<table>" +
"<tr><td id='tblTitle'>Highway Cameras</td><td id='tblTitle2'></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td id='tblTitleLine'></td><td id='tblTitleLine2'></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td></td><td></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td id='tblMainline1'>description</td><td id='tblSubline2'> " + graphic.attributes.descriptio + " </td></tr>" +
"<tr><td id='tblSubline2' colspan='2'><img src= " + graphic.attributes.image_url + "?t=" + new Date().getTime() + " /></td></tr>" +
//Notice my little time stamp change to the url above
"</table><hr>";
}
function onLayerUpdateEnd(){
//when the layer is refereshed if the popup has a selected feature then
//force the popup to get the content again
if(map.infoWindow.count > 0){
var graphic = map.infoWindow.getSelectedFeature();
map.infoWindow.setFeatures([graphic]);
}
}
var HighwayCameras = new FeatureLayer("https://services.arcgis.com/DO4gTjwJVIJ7O9Ca/arcgis/rest/services/Camera_Location_VDOT/FeatureServer...", {
mode: FeatureLayer.MODE_ONDEMAND,
visible: true,
opacity: .5,
outFields: ["*"],
infoTemplate: infoHighwayCameras,
refreshInterval: 0.1
});
legendLayers3.push({
layer: HighwayCameras,
title: 'Highway Cameras'
});
HighwayCameras.on('update-end', onLayerUpdateEnd);

Jay,
OK, where we were disconnection is that you need to use a function to set the content and not just a string in the setContent method.
infoHighwayCameras.setContent(getTextContent);
function getTextContent(graphic) {
return "<table>" +
"<tr><td id='tblTitle'>Highway Cameras</td><td id='tblTitle2'></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td id='tblTitleLine'></td><td id='tblTitleLine2'></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td></td><td></td></tr>" +
"<tr><td id='tblMainline1'>image_url</td><td id='tblSubline2'><i>TEST1 <a href='#' onclick='onclickFunction(" + graphic.attributes.image_url + ")'>Click Me!</a>." +
"</td></tr></table><hr>";
}
